The Next Fest Build Is Live — Abilities, a Living Galaxy, and a Mountain of Polish


Steam Next Fest kicks off June 15, and Infinite Empire's demo is in it. This update is the biggest the demo has ever gotten, with three and a half weeks of work, and most of the game's systems got touched. Here's what's new since the last update.

⚡ Abilities are online

Thirteen combat abilities just came online: Warp Jump, Void Bomb, Nova Cannon, summoned drone and bomber wings, curses, marks, and emergency buffs. They unlock through your empire's progression tree, and new runs start with a starter set already known.Equipping them is real now too: the Builder has a proper ability loadout panel so you can click a slot, pick from everything you've unlocked, read the tooltip, done. In combat, abilities use aim-then-fire targeting: press the hotkey to prime, get a reticle and range ring with pulsing highlights on whatever you're about to hit, then click to fire. Right-click or Esc cancels free and cooldowns only spend when you commit.

👑 A galaxy that fights for keeps

  • Every faction now has its own personality, doctrine, and long-term goals. Some hunger for territory, some chase vengeance, artifacts, or trade routes. They mobilize for sustained offensives, commit to multi-stage sieges, and genuinely kill each other's captains.

  • Captains hold grudges. Kill someone's comrade and they will remember — and hunt you. Killers build named kill-streak reputations in the galaxy news. Wandering Prophets rise in contested space. A broken empire's survivors can rally into a brand-new hostile faction.

  • The campaign escalates through eras — expansion, consolidation, twilight — with fresh offensives whenever the late game threatens to stall into a stalemate.

  • Your own captains can no longer die permanently. A defeated captain is knocked out, retreats to refit, and comes back with their name, levels, and story intact. The news announces both the fall and the return.

  • Galaxy news is sorted by significance now. Defining Moments pinned in gold, Notable Events below, routine siege chatter at the bottom. The big story beats never get buried.

💥 Combat got a face-lift

  • Living nebula skies! Every battle plays out under a procedural nebula unique to its sector, tinted by the local biome, drifting in parallax behind the stars.

  • Explosions ripple space itself. Core deaths fire a screen-distorting shockwave tinted by the dying faction's colors.

  • Battle damage has real depth now: armor chars and thins, torn holes open into interior rooms, and catastrophic hits blast clean through to open space.

  • The galaxy map got a visual overhaul too, with glowing system orbs, textured territory, glowing travel lanes, and your map token is now an actual snapshot of your ship, battle damage and all.

🛠️ Builder, rebuilt

The tool panel is a clean accordion now with Hull Appearance, Shapes, Struts, Texture Paint, Depth Shape (which now has a proper theme dropdown and a new three-click Curve mode for smooth hull paneling). You can name your ship. Hovering a module shows its loot rarity, condition, and stat modifiers at a glance. Repairs are instant, undo behaves, struts draw the moment you place them, and the Builder politely refuses to launch a ship that can't actually fly.

💾 Saves, fixed for real

Three manual slots plus three rotating autosaves. A manual save is a frozen snapshot an autosave can never overwrite. The save-game freeze is gone for good (saving runs silently in the background now), the Load window is faster and groups saves by empire with your ship's snapshot on each one, and the Steam Cloud "over quota" errors are dead.

🎮 Steam Deck + 41 achievements

The demo is playable on Steam Deck out of the box now — point with the trackpad, press A, and it just works. Menus, Builder, settings panels: all reworked to fit the screen, with the UI scaled up for legibility. And there are 41 Steam achievements to chase across combat, building, and conquest.

…plus the kitchen sink

Off-screen contact pips for enemies, allies, and torpedoes beyond the screen edge. A combat camera that starts centered on YOUR ship, with an optional rotation-lock mode. Point-defense is a real sixth weapon group with an Auto/Manual toggle. Bind two keys to every action. A heads-up for returning players: spacebar pauses combat now instead of firing — left-click and controller trigger still shoot. Plus a DX12 launch fix, a game-wide texture filtering pass so nothing shimmers when you zoom out, and a few hundred fixes beyond that. The full list lives in the in-game News panel.

Before the 15th

One more pass is in flight: performance tuning for large late-game battles. It'll be in the build that greets Next Fest.

Play it

The demo on this page is the Next Fest build. If you play it and something delights you — or breaks — the discussion board is right there, and I read everything. If you want to see where this goes, a wishlist genuinely helps more than anything else you can do.See you at the fest. 🚀
